About the role:

Location: Offshore/UK

Hours: Variable Based on set contract

The core function of the role is to act as a Motive focal point and support the Hose Integrity Management (HIM) inspection surveys offshore and onshore and Flexible Hose Assembly replacement scopes on a client offshore installation, vessel, or onshore base of operations.  

The Offshore Hose Technician will be the focal point for each specific scope of work communicating effectively with the client and relevant Motive Offshore Group departments.

Product

  • Mobilise offshore as the lead technician and Motive focal point to carry out hose integrity management work scopes and flexible hose assembly replacement work scopes on client installations and vessels. 
  • Carry out CVI (close visual inspection) on client flexible hose assemblies and fittings whilst in situ, in line with Motive HIM process and procedure.
  • Identify flexible Hose Assembly types, fittings, and condition, in line with Motive HIM procedure. 
  • Affix Motive custom hose tags and register flexible hose assemblies on Motive Motion Kinetic HIM system, as directed by Hose Integrity Manager.               
  • Carry out hose assembly tasks, techniques for flexible hose replacement and carry out in situ hydrostatic pressure testing on flexible hose assemblies while adhering to hose manufacturer process and procedure for assembly and testing activity at client site, following direction from Hose Integrity Manager utilising scope work pack and internal processes and procedures. 
  • Recommending possible solutions to problems/concerns identified with client hose assemblies, applications or operating procedures and carry out remedial actions when appropriate. 
  • Lead the use of Motion Kinetic Software for inputting client asset hose technical specification, generating FHA (Flexible Hose Assembly) data collection reports, FHA defect reports and the creation of client asset hose registers. Provide support and training for trainees on the function and use.    
  • Responsibility of Completing Daily Client Service Record Forms in full, with accurate times and descriptions obtaining signed approval from the client. 
  • Create daily reports and ensure submission to relevant client and Motive contacts following the end of each work shift, with direction from the Hose Integrity Manager.  
  • Demobilise equipment at the worksite and prepare for shipping, completing any necessary cargo manifests.
  • Adherence to client safe working practices and quality assurance systems
  • Participation in site TBT (Toolbox Talks) and TRA (Task Risk Assessments) as required by client.

Required skills / knowledge:

  • Significant experience in Hose Integrity Management, Hose Assembly and Hydraulics. 
  • BFPA (British Fluid Power Association) Training Certification 
  • Full Offshore certification.
